Earlier today we told you that Rogers Canada has confirmed that they will launch the Blackberry Torch on September 24. And now we just heard that Telus will also release the Blackberry Torch on the same date as Rogers.

Telus announced their plan to release Blackberry Torch on Sept 24 via Twitter. According to another source the Telus Blackberry Torch price will be the same as Rogers Blackberry Torch, which will be $199.99 with 3 year contract plan

Just recently we heard a great news for Canadian people. Bell, Rogers, TELUS and the Virgin Mobile have just confirmed that they will offer the Blackberry Torch and all of the Blackberry 6 goodness as soon as possible. Both TELUS and Rogers have said that the Blackberry Torch will be available later this year. Meanwhile, Bell gave a more precise Blackberry Torch release date on this year’s fall season.

Unfortunately, we still haven’t found out the exact availability and pricing for the Canadian Blackberry Torch 9800. But based on the AT&T BB Torch Pricing, the Blackberry Torch price in Canada should be around  $199.99 with two year agreement.

Telus seems to work pretty fast on the Blackberry Tour release (or at least the first to leaked the information). Recently there was a leaked information about the release date of the Blackberry Tour and it seems that the Canadian carrier will launch the Tour on July 15. So the rumor buzzing over at Blackberry forums over at the internet is pretty much true.

However, despite of the nice info about the release date, there was also a bit unpleasant news about the price of the Blackberry Tour. So if you are a Canadian and wanted to buy the new Blackberry Tour on a 3-year contract, you’ll have to spend $249.99 as long as you are on a $20/month or higher calling plan with a data add-on of $15/month or more.That’s expensive, man. Great news for all blackberry fans in Canada! There’s a new info from Telus that the carrier has made all current blackberry phones including Pearl, Curve and Storm cheaper! So from today, 17th June 2009, you can enjoy the great and cheaper prize of: BlackBerry Storm is now $149 with 3-year term from $249; BlackBerry Curve 8330 $49 with 3-year, $449 no contract (was $549); and BlackBerry Pearl 8130 $0 with 3-year, $329.99 no contract (was $499)… Continue reading ‘Telus Pearl, Curve and Storm have gotten cheaper!’ »
